Several economic and logistical elements contribute to how petrol is priced in Karur.
Karur follows India’s daily fuel revision cycle, with petrol prices refreshed sharply at 6 AM. This ensures that the city’s fuel rates stay in step with overnight movements in global crude oil benchmarks and fluctuations in the Rupee’s exchange value against major currencies.
Indian Oil Corporation, Bharat Petroleum Corporation Limited, and Hindustan Petroleum Corporation Limited apply the revised prices at their Karur outlets at the same time. This uniform implementation promotes pricing clarity and avoids abrupt differences across neighbourhood pumps.
Motorists can view the updated petrol price each morning through official websites, SMS alerts, or mobile applications offered by these fuel companies. Monitoring the rate regularly helps individuals plan refuelling stops at appropriate times and manage their commuting costs judiciously.

Daily petrol price revisions in Karur reflect overnight changes in international oil markets, foreign-exchange rates, and regional logistics and tax adjustments.
In Karur the final fuel price is derived from global crude oil costs, inland transport and storage charges, Tamil Nadu VAT, central excise duty and retailer commissions.
Price differences within Karur happen because fuel delivery distances vary, storage availability differs and dealer operational costs may be higher in remote zones.
Petrol in Karur is not taxed under the GST regime; instead, it carries central excise duty and state VAT which drive the retail price.
